The role

The United Nations Environment Programme (UNEP) is seeking a Programme Management Officer to join the Climate Change Adaptation Unit in Accra, Ghana. The incumbent will provide technical guidance, manage project delivery, and ensure adherence to financial and administrative regulations. The role involves coordinating adaptation policy processes, analyzing development data, and fostering stakeholder relationships to support climate resilience initiatives. This position requires strong expertise in climate change adaptation and project management within a global environmental context.

What you'll do

  • Provide technical guidance for project objectives and identify suitable interventions.
  • Monitor project progress by analyzing work-plans, reports, and socioeconomic data.
  • Manage project resources, including budget estimates and expenditure forecasting.
  • Organize consultative meetings, seminars, and workshops with national and regional stakeholders.
  • Draft technical reports, policy briefs, and communication materials for project visibility.

What it takes

  • Advanced university degree in management, environmental science, economics, or related fields.
  • Minimum of 5 years of progressively responsible experience in project/programme management.
  • Proven expertise in climate change adaptation, environmental, or sustainable development work.
  • Proficiency in data analytics and interpretation for decision-making.
  • Excellent command of English; valid authorization to work in Ghana (Nationals only).
